Summary:English Storytelling is an activity to improve skills and creativity with English. English is not the main language in Indonesia, making it difficult for some children to get used to English. This activity is expected to help children in vocabulary knowledge and sentence construction. However, in elementary school English Storytelling activities, many children are found telling stories without understanding the flow of the story they are telling, so the story can sound monotonous. One way to get children to learn more about stories is by interacting with the stories. Stories are easier to understand through pictures. Therefore, the research will examine the application of images in learning media as an alternative facility for learning English Storytelling creatively using conventional media such as picture book and learning media that are tailored to learning needs.
